|
@@ -2537,11 +2537,8 @@ public class CourseScheduleServiceImpl extends BaseServiceImpl<Long, CourseSched
|
|
|
oldCourseSchedule.setEndClassTime(DateUtil.addMinutes(courseSchedule.getStartClassTime(),practiceCourseMinutes));
|
|
|
List<CourseSchedule> courseSchedules=new ArrayList<>();
|
|
|
courseSchedules.add(oldCourseSchedule);
|
|
|
-// courseSchedules.forEach(e->{
|
|
|
-// e.setId(null);
|
|
|
-// });
|
|
|
checkNewCourseSchedules(courseSchedules,false);
|
|
|
- oldCourseSchedule.setId(courseSchedule.getId());
|
|
|
+ teacherAttendanceDao.batchUpdateTeacher(courseSchedules.stream().map(e->e.getId()).collect(Collectors.toSet()),oldCourseSchedule.getActualTeacherId());
|
|
|
courseScheduleDao.update(oldCourseSchedule);
|
|
|
}
|
|
|
|